• 标签: 分布式系统 共 243 个结果.
  • 在构建可扩展的分布式系统时,选择适当的架构模式是至关重要的。这决定了系统的可扩展性、可靠性和性能。本篇博客将介绍5种常用的架构模式,帮助你构建可扩展的分布式系统。 1. 分层架构模式 分层架构模式是最常见和最简单的架构模式之一。该模式将系统划分为...
  • 在当今的软件开发领域,构建可扩展的分布式系统架构已成为一项重要的任务。随着用户数量和数据量的快速增长,传统的单体应用已经无法满足大规模应用的需求。为了应对这些挑战,我们需要设计和实现可扩展的分布式系统架构。 什么是可扩展的分布式系统架构? 可扩展...
  • 在现代互联网应用中,数据的存储和管理是一个关键的问题。分布式存储系统因其高可扩展性和更好的容错性而被广泛采用。然而,由于分布式存储系统中包含了大量的节点和数据,如果没有良好的容错和恢复机制,系统可能面临数据丢失和服务中断等严重问题。因此,分布式存...
  • 引言 随着互联网的快速发展,越来越多的企业开始将传统的单体应用架构转变为微服务架构,以应对快速变化的市场需求和复杂的业务需求。微服务架构通过将应用程序拆分为多个小型、自治的服务模块,便于团队独立开发、测试和部署。本文将介绍微服务架构设计的基本概念...
  • 在现代技术领域,分布式系统已经成为构建高可靠性和高性能应用程序的关键技术之一。分布式系统的设计和构建需要考虑各种因素,包括性能、可扩展性、容错性和一致性。本文将重点介绍构建可扩展的分布式系统的关键策略。 1. 高水平的横向扩展 横向扩展是构建可扩...
  • 在信息时代,分布式系统已经成为各个领域的重要构建方式之一。构建高可用性的分布式系统是保障系统稳定运行和用户体验的关键。下面将介绍构建高可用性分布式系统的一些技术要点。 1. 异地多活部署 为了提供高可用性,可以将系统部署于多个地理位置,实现异地多...
  • 引言 随着互联网技术的不断发展和应用普及,分布式系统在当今的计算环境中扮演着重要角色。分布式系统是由多台独立计算机组成的协调工作集合,通过网络连接进行通信和协作来完成任务。本篇博客将介绍分布式系统的设计与实现,并通过几个具体的例子来说明其重要性和...
  • 介绍 分布式消息队列(Distributed Message Queue)是一种用于在分布式系统中传递消息的重要工具。它们可以在不同的组件之间异步传输消息,提高系统的可靠性和扩展性。Kafka和RabbitMQ是两个流行的分布式消息队列,它们在设...
  • 分布式存储系统是一种将数据存储在多个物理设备上的系统,用于解决单一存储设备容量有限、性能瓶颈和可靠性问题。它将数据分散存储在多个节点上,并通过网络连接这些节点,实现高可用性、高性能和可伸缩性。 1. 引言 在当今大数据时代,传统的存储系统已经无法...
  • 什么是分布式系统 分布式系统是由多台计算机组成的系统,这些计算机通过网络连接在一起,并协同工作以完成复杂的任务。与单个计算机系统相比,分布式系统能够提供更高的性能、可靠性和可扩展性。 核心概念 1. 透明性 透明性是指分布式系统的用户对系统底层的...